Abstract

ABSTRACT Objective: To correlate facet tropism with the side and location of the intervertebral disc in which the lumbar disc herniation occurred. Methods: A retrospective descriptive study that evaluated Magnetic Resonance Imaging of 255 patients with lumbar disc herniation undergoing surgical treatment with the Spine Group of the Hospital Ortopédico de Passo Fundo between 2002 and 2014. The total patient number was stratified according to the side affected by the herniated disc (right or left), location of the hernia in the intervertebral disc (central, centrolateral, foraminal and extraforaminal) and demographic data, such as age, gender etc. The degree of facet joint tropism was measured by the Karakan method and classified as mild (difference less than 7º); moderate (between 7º and 15º) and severe (difference greater than 15º). Results: A statistical significant relationship (p= 0.023) was observed between the facet joint tropism and the side where the lumbar disc herniation occurred. No correlation was found between facet joint tropism and location of the herniation on the intervertebral disc. Conclusions: The degree of facet tropism presents a statistical significant correlation with the side of the intervertebral disc in which the lumbar disc herniation will develop. Level of Evidence: II. Type of study: Retrospective study.
